Подскажите где можно почитать про PE формат на русском языке (с другими напряг), наиболее полно и толково. А так же про описание и назначение секций, и создание секций с нестандартными названиями средствами компилятора (если такое возможно).
Вообще то название секции не отражает его назначение. У каждой секции есть флаг (тип - код/данные и модификаторы чтения/запись/исполнение и т. д.) Есть такие компиляторы в природе. К примеру Microsoft Visual C/C++ компилятор способен размещать переменные/процедуры в иных секциях заданных программистом.
Или допустим компилятор поддерживает генерацию объектных файлов, тогда можно на nasm/fasm создать еще один объектный файл содержащий заданную пользователем секцию и в конечном итоге скомпоновать файл полученный компилятором с файлом полученным ассемблером. к примеру: Код (Text): // test.cpp extern "C" int myVar; Код (Text): ; mysec.asm (fasm) format ms coff public myVar section '.mysec' data readable writeable myVar dd ? скомпоновать test.obj и mysec.obj вместе.